Which characteristic is essential for a trial to be classified as randomized?

Explanation:
A trial is classified as randomized primarily when the allocation of participants is determined by a randomization process. This means that individuals are assigned to different groups (such as treatment or control) based on a method that is random and not influenced by any biases. Randomization is essential because it helps ensure that the groups being compared are similar in all respects, except for the treatment being tested. This similarity allows for a clearer conclusion about the effectiveness of the intervention being studied. The other options do not reflect the criteria for randomization. For example, if participants self-select their groups, this can introduce bias and compromise the integrity of the trial. Additionally, while it’s common for all participants to receive the same treatment in controlled trials, this is not a defining feature of randomization itself. Lastly, the involvement of external auditors in data analysis does not pertain to how participants are allocated to groups, which is the crux of what makes a trial randomized. Therefore, the essential characteristic lies in the randomized allocation process.
